Description
George Foreman (au); Joel Engel (au). No athlete has captured America’s imagination as has George Foreman. In his teens in 1968, he won an Olympic gold medal in Mexico City. In his early 20s, he destroyed the invincible Joe Frazier to capture boxing’s heavyweight championship. But soon after he lost his crown to Muhammad Ali. By 1977, Foreman had quit fighting, undergone a religious conversion, & begun preaching on Texas street corners. A decade later, in Nov. 1994, at the age of 45, he recaptured boxing’s crown. Here Foreman tells the incredible story of his triumphs, defeats, & comeback. He writes openly of his troubled childhood, the rage that fueled his early athletic triumphs, his many marriages, & his communion with God. An inspiring, unforgettable saga. Photos.
